The United Nations Climate Action Summit will be held in New York on the 23rd (midnight at 23rd Japan time) with the participation of leaders from various countries to stop global warming. About 60 countries, including European countries, China, and India, will be on stage to announce additional targets for reducing greenhouse gas emissions. On the other hand, in the US and Japan, leaders did not participate, there was no opportunity to enter the stage, and the temperature difference was highlighted.

Mr. Guterres said that the pace of reduction of greenhouse gas emissions has been slow even after the adoption of the international framework for global warming countermeasures, “Paris Agreement”. I am worried that I will not be able to achieve the goal set by the agreement to keep it below 1.5 degrees. To strengthen measures, ▽ No real greenhouse gas emissions until 2050, 45% reduction by 30 years ▽ Cancellation of new coal-fired power generation after 2020 ▽ Prohibition of fossil fuel subsidies ▽ Tax on emissions Each country was asked to introduce a carbon tax to be imposed.

At the meeting on the 22nd, he said, “The summit asks countries to take a strong stance toward combating global warming.” The summit is expected to emphasize that it is a “climate emergency”.

The summit will include representatives from over 60 countries, including Prime Minister Modi of India, French President Macron, and British Prime Minister Johnson. Merkel talks about new measures to reduce greenhouse gas emissions by 55% in 30 years, and the UK, European countries, Chile and others are expected to declare zero real emissions in 50 years. Argentina, Costa Rica, France, etc. will also announce that they will submit reduction targets by 30 years by next year.

China is the world's largest greenhouse gas emissions countries on behalf of the Xi Jinping Jintao, Wang Yi, State Councilor and Foreign Minister to speech. There are plans to promise to accelerate global warming countermeasures, but there are criticisms that coal-fired power is being supported in Asian and African countries through “One Belt and One Road” development investment.

Meanwhile, President Trump is absent from the US, the world's second largest emission country. President Trump, who has declared the departure of the Paris Agreement, plans to hold “Religious Freedom” and a bilateral meeting in New York on the same day as the summit. The White House officials say that “We place emphasis on bilateral relations. Individual diplomacy is the president's strength” and distances from the United Nations multilateral diplomacy.

In Japan, there is no statement of an accumulation of reduction targets, etc. Shinjiro Koizumi will enter the venue, but no stage is scheduled. (New York = Keisuke Katori)
